3.1 magnitude earthquake strikes Haryana’s Jhajjar

Mild tremors were felt here after a 3.1 magnitude earthquake hit the region on Sunday afternoon but there were no casualties.

According to the National Centre for Seismology, the quake was recorded at 4.10 pm with its epicentre 7 km east-northeast of Jhajjar at a depth of 10 km.

On July 17, a 3.3 magnitude quake was felt in areas adjoining Rohtak district, which was the third one in Rohtak-Jhajjar region within 10 days.

Prior to the Rohtak quake, an earthquake of magnitude 3.7 had struck near Jhajjar. A stronger quake of magnitude 4.4 had struck Jhajjar, the tremors of which were felt across the national capital and adjoining areas.
